I had the idea of building points in my mind from listening to a few of you a year or two ago. This year I seriously looked into it and I'm flabbergasted by the math. Correct me if I'm wrong but basically you're going to spend about $1,000 over ten years building your points per species then about $1,000 once you get drawn... already in for it $2,000 for one animal and then there's the cost of your scouting trip(s) and your hunt  :yike:

No wonder people go hunt Africa  :bash: 7 species for $5,000 sounds cheap now!

Look at the alternative.  You can put in for points in WY, CO, UT, NV, MT, WA, NM, etc. and invest maybe 7500 over the next 10 years so that 10 years from now you start drawing a once-in-a-lifetime hunt once every other year or so.  Or you could save your money and spend 7500 bucks to go on a guided moose hunt in BC or $12k to go in AK.  Seems like points are a better investment to me.

Africa doesn't have a huge draw to me mostly because I love the North American big game animals that I see and photograph on a regular basis.

Dropped out two years ago with 10 pts for each. If you look at the better sheep units I would have had to beat random odds or wait about 20 more years. Average sheep in most units as well. For moose the units I was looking into have been decimated by wolves. Luckily I only paid the higher fee one year and then dropped. I guess maybe all those points helped me draw a sheep tag for Washington last year. Don't know how else I beat the odds here. Good luck to those putting in. You will get a moose tag but sheep is slim odds unless you are sitting within a point or two of the top right now but someone has to be drawn in the random.
